Convergencia, a social science journal, is in its 30th year, founded by teachers from FCPyS at UAEM

Due to the academic interest of the faculty of the Faculty of Political and Social Sciences of the Autonomous State University of Mexico (UAEMex), the Convergencia Revista de Ciencias Sociales was established, which in its thirtieth anniversary has established itself as an official spokesperson on the subject. In Iberoamerican.

Over the course of thirty years, this scientific space has undergone various changes, the most important of which was the establishment of academic standards for published research, explained the editorial director of Convergencia Revista de Ciencias Sociales, Guillermina Díaz Pérez. It was later incorporated into CONACyT's quality journals and indexed in Scopus, Clarivate Analytics, and Latindex, as one of the most cited journals in these indexes.

Moreover, due to the increase in online consultation, it has moved from being a print journal to a fully digital journal, and has been able to decide which articles will be archived online, something that very few journals in South and Central America have done.

“There is no doubt that thanks to these processes the journal has been strengthened; he added: “Currently, Convergence faces the challenge of knowing and complying with modern worldviews on the digital publishing of scholarly work with open and fair access, but also maintaining rigor, editorial excellence and diversity of published works.” “.

In this sense, Díaz Pérez stated that thanks to the guidance of the Redalyc scientific information system of the Autonomous University of Mexico, it has become a cutting-edge open access journal; In addition, he honored the editorial team of Veronica Hernández Sánchez, María de los Ángeles Ayala Rogel, Amelia Suárez Arriaga, Lizeth Domínguez Gómez, and Caridad Rodríguez Hernández, because thanks to their work and commitment a research and analysis community was created. Which transcended borders, and which was enriched by the diversity of opinions and works of researchers around the world.

Finally, Díaz Pérez recognized the importance of the student body, as they were part of the history of this scholarly space, collaborating in the production, reading, and publication of the journal, making them an essential component of Convergencia's work.
